SOC 49-3043 · Washington · BLS OEWS May 2024
The median salary for Rail Car Repairers in Washington is $79,481 per year ($38.21/hr). This is 21% higher than the national median of $65,686. The middle 50% earn between $62,492 and $96,997 annually. Top earners at the 90th percentile reach $111,318.
| Percentile | Hourly Rate | Annual Salary | vs National |
|---|---|---|---|
| P10 | $26.57 | $55,269 | +21.0% |
| P25 | $30.04 | $62,492 | +21.0% |
| P50MEDIAN | $38.21 | $79,481 | +21.0% |
| P75 | $46.63 | $96,997 | +21.0% |
| P90 | $53.52 | $111,318 | +21.0% |
